C m(maj7)/G
The C m(maj7) chord consists of the C (Perfect unison), D# (Minor third), G (Perfect fifth) and B (Major seventh) notes, with G as the bass note.

How to play the C m(maj7)/G chord
- Play G as the lowest bass note in the left hand
- Find C (Root) on the piano keyboard
- Add D# (Minor third) — 3 semitones above C
- Add G (Perfect fifth) — 7 semitones above C
- Add B (Major seventh) — 11 semitones above C
- Press all 5 notes simultaneously to sound the C m(maj7)/G chord
